Since 2004, more than 1,800 newspapers have closed; with the remaining ones cutting news coverage, shrinking the paper's size, and/or ceasing production of a print edition. New initiatives are underway to reimagine how journalism is funded and structured. One program, Report for America (RFA), is modeled after AmeriCorps and places journalists into local newsrooms to report on under-covered issues and communities. It aims to install 1,000 journalists in understaffed newsrooms by 2022 by paying half their salaries. As part of the 2019 Annual Meeting, Steve Waldman, Co-Founder and President of Report for America, speaks to the City Club about the future of local news and the free press in an increasingly digital world.
